How they compare

Bhutan currently reports 2.70 million kg against 2.50 million kg in Puerto Rico, a difference of 197,400 kg.

That makes Bhutan's figure about 1.1 times Puerto Rico's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Puerto Rico ahead.

Bhutan ranks 147th and Puerto Rico ranks 149th of 198 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Bhutan averaged higher in 1 and Puerto Rico in 4.

The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ions from Crops provides estimates of emissions associated with crop processes, namely 1) crop residues, 2) burning of crop residues, and 3) rice cultivation and the application of nitrogen (N) fertilizers, including mineral and chemical fertilizers, to soils. Estimates are computed at Tier 1 following the 2006 IPCC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 2006).
